CVE-2020-29130Out-of-bounds Read in Project Libslirp

CWE-125Out-of-bounds Read8 documents7 sources
Severity
4.3MEDIUMNVD
EPSS
0.5%
top 35.50%
CISA KEV
Not in KEV
Exploit
No known exploits
Timeline
PublishedNov 26
Latest updateMay 24

Description

slirp.c in libslirp through 4.3.1 has a buffer over-read because it tries to read a certain amount of header data even if that exceeds the total packet length.

CVSS vector

C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:L/I:N/A:NExploitability: 2.8 | Impact: 1.4

Affected Packages4 packages

Debianlibslirp_project/libslirp< 4.4.0-1+3
Ubuntulibslirp_project/libslirp< 4.1.0-2ubuntu2.2
Debianqemu/qemu< 1:4.1-2+3

Also affects: Debian Linux 9.0, Fedora 32, 33

🔴Vulnerability Details

4
GHSA
GHSA-h334-6xv9-jfg4: slirp2022-05-24
OSV
libslirp vulnerabilities2021-07-15
CVEList
CVE-2020-29130: slirp2020-11-26
OSV
CVE-2020-29130: slirp2020-11-26

📋Vendor Advisories

3
Ubuntu
libslirp vulnerabilities2021-07-15
Red Hat
QEMU: slirp: out-of-bounds access while processing ARP/NCSI packets2020-11-26
Debian
CVE-2020-29130: libslirp - slirp.c in libslirp through 4.3.1 has a buffer over-read because it tries to rea...2020
CVE-2020-29130 — Out-of-bounds Read in Project Libslirp | cvebase